Gopal, who works as a lab assistant at Islamia Girls Inter College in Bareilly district of Uttar Pradesh, has prepared a unique and eco-friendly project. After five years of hard work, he has prepared a model train named Indian Water Train IWT. Which can run on its own by generating electricity from water. This model of the train has also been successfully tested.
In fact, three students of the school, Laiba, Yasmin and Kashifa, have been fully supporting Gopal in this project for the last three years. These students have made various technical and creative contributions in preparing this project. Gopal told that this train is completely based on eco-friendly technology. By pouring only 250 ml of water in this small model, it can run up to 50 meters.
This initiative is related to the development of the country
He told that this train generates electricity from water and runs its motor with the same electricity, due to which it does not need any external power source. Gopal believes that his effort is not only a new step in the field of science and technology, but it also promotes government campaigns like Make in India, Atmanirbhar Bharat and Sustainable Development. He is also engaged in the process of patenting this model.
Where did he get the idea from?
Gopal works at Islamia Girls College in Bareilly and is the son of canteen operator Jagdish. He did his early education from Bishop Mandal Inter College. After doing BSc, he also prepared for UPSC without coaching. He has a special interest in scientific experiments. He often keeps learning something new by collecting information from YouTube and taking inspiration from that, he prepared the model of this water train.
